    #61
    Great ideas and build...thx I been using Cattle panels/Tpost/Pallets for years for blinds..also you can get metal clips/or weld /braze..to hold panels together..
    I make build fst with Ty Wraps..once I get it RIGHT then I weld/clip /braze...But if you get Quality Ty Wraps or Tie wire ..its basically permanent...but easily torn apart and moved...The other thing I found is That Vinyl that the use for bill boards and banners(used or outdated is free to low cost) ..is TUFF stuff and makes great roof and or sidewalls ..and is paintable and stands up to sun well''..I put grommets in mine
